1. Bet9ja Foundation 

Case Studies of Successful Social Impact Programs in Nigeria - Bet9ja foundation

  • The Challenge: Nigeria faces significant healthcare disparities, especially in rural and underserved communities. Access to hospitals, trained professionals, and essential equipment remains a major barrier to proper care.

  • Our Approach: The Bet9ja Foundation tackles this complex issue through a multi-pronged strategy:

    • Infrastructure Upgrades: Renovating and equipping existing clinics and hospitals to improve quality of care.

    • Capacity Building: Training local healthcare workers, empowering them with essential skills and knowledge.

    • Targeted Support: Focusing on maternal and child health, donating supplies, and raising awareness of preventative care.

  • Measurable Impact:

    • Renovated over ten (10) healthcare facilities across multiple states, significantly increasing access to care.

    • Trained hundreds of healthcare workers, enabling sustained improvement in rural communities.

    • Reached thousands of women and children with health education and essential supplies.

  • Keys to Success:

    • Collaboration: The foundation partners with local NGOs and community leaders, ensuring their efforts align with on-the-ground needs.

    • Focus: By targeting specific areas of healthcare, we ensure a measurable and sustainable impact.

5. Wellbeing Foundation Africa (WBFA) 

  • The Challenge: Nigeria faces one of the world's highest maternal and infant mortality rates. This is driven by a lack of skilled midwives, inadequate healthcare facilities, and limited access to emergency care during childbirth.

  • Their Approach: WBFA tackles this crisis through:

    • Midwife Training: Upskilling midwives in emergency obstetrics to handle birth complications and improve outcomes.

    • MamaKits: Equipping expectant mothers with essential supplies for safe and hygienic childbirth.

    • Health Advocacy: Working with policymakers to improve maternal and child health systems.

6. RecyclePoints 

  • The Challenge: Nigeria grapples with a waste management crisis, with overflowing landfills, pollution, and low recycling rates. Many lack the financial incentive to participate in recycling.

  • Their Approach: RecyclePoints gamifies recycling, making it both accessible and rewarding:

    • Collection Network: Partnering with residential areas and businesses to make recycling convenient.

    • Points-for-Waste: Individuals earn points based on the quantity and type of recyclables they turn in.

    • Rewards System: Points are redeemable for household goods, groceries, or cash equivalents.
